Runbook: Scanline barcode bridge

If warehouse scans stop flowing into Cartwheel, it's almost always the bridge service on the Dunmore floor box wedging after a USB hiccup. Bounce the service first — nine times out of ten that fixes it. If not, check the queue depth before escalating. When restarting, make sure the bridge comes up with these settings.

deployment values, yafop-bajef:
[gilok]
team = ulaius
access_code = ac_423664
host = gilok.sivrelhq.corp
port = 9200
owner = pelius.istax
peer = eliok.torvasoft.internal

Subject: Licensing Dispute Update

Hi all,

Quick heads-up for finance: the dispute with Bramleigh Softworks over the Ostrafex toolkit license is heating up. Their counsel claims our deployment exceeds seat limits; our logs say otherwise. We've paused the renewal payment and set aside a reserve just in case. Don't book the disputed amount as settled until legal confirms. Where this lands affects broader plans, summarized in the confidential note below.

Thanks,
Greta

management briefing: Istaelix Group is in early talks to buy Sorysax Logistics for about $496.2 million. The Kasox launch date is October 3, and nothing goes to the press before then. Legal wants the Norokax Foods term sheet withdrawn before April 25.

### 4.1.0 — Key rotation

Heads up, new folks: we rotated the signing key used for Nightshade admin dashboard releases (yes, the one that ships the shiny dark-mode build). Old key is dead as of this version — builds verified against it will fail the gate. Update your local verify script and re-check the 4.1.0 bundle using the new key below.

release key, fahaf-bajof: bky3_Xam